At Illinois Beach State Park south unit this morning a Sharp-shinned Hawk flew straight at me from across the river so close I thought it would land on me and I could clearly see the squared off tail.  Standing still with camouflage really worked or my bad hair had it thinking it was going to catch a rodent, not sure which.  Also saw a small flock of Wood Ducks fly by, a flock of Golden-crowned Kinglets stopped by for a while, a Downy Woodpecker, Rusty Blackbirds, Brown Creeper, Palm Warbler, and a few other small birds I didn't get a good look at to identify.  A young Pied-billed Grebe was on the river.
